Win For Buster Profile

Win For Buster is a 3 year old bay gelding. Win For Buster is trained by D R Harrison, at Serpentine and owned by Bridge Patrol Lodge (Mgr: D R Harrison), R J Fuller, K E Holly, Mrs C A Holly, R J O'Malley, A J O'Malley, R E Roney Nominees Pty Ltd (Mgr: R E Roney), C E Sullivan, B M Williams, B A Byrne, L M Harrison, Mrs Y M Harrison & L J Bell.

Win For Buster’s last race event was at 01/07/2026 and their next race is on 16/07/2026 at Pinjarra.

Win For Buster Racing Form

Career form is wins, 2 seconds, thirds from 5 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$14,685.

With a 0% Win Percentage and 40% Place Percentage. Win For Buster's last race event was at Belmont Park.

Exposed form for its last starts is 9-2-4-9-2.
